You Will:

  • Lead the full engineering lifecycle of MV/HV power generation and interconnection projects-from early scoping through detailed electrical design, procurement support, construction oversight, and commissioning
  • Serve as a senior lead technical and engineering authority for substation, protection, and power generation systems, providing PE-level review, and final design approval
  • Review, develop, and integrate engineering drawings, specifications, and calculations across electrical, mechanical, and controls/SCADA disciplines for substations, switchyards, protection and relaying schemes, and systems including natural gas-fired generation and battery energy storage (BESS)
  • Conduct formal electrical design reviews at key milestones (30%, 60%, 90%, IFC), with particular attention to MV and HV equipment, protection, and grounding design, and drive timely resolution of technical comments
  • Lead technical support for utility interconnection activities, including interconnection studies, utility protection requirements, relay settings review, commissioning coordination, and compliance with utility and ISO requirements.
  • Collaborate with internal teams, external engineers, OEMs, and construction partners to ensure adherence to design requirements, safety standards, performance expectations, and equipment specifications
  • Lead multi-disciplinary engineering teams and coordinate work across internal stakeholders, consultants, EPC partners, OEMs, and operations personnel.
  • Lead technical evaluations of bids and vendor proposals, including switchgear, transformers, protection systems, natural gas reciprocating engines, and instrumentation
  • Develop and refine electrical scopes of work, RFQs, design specifications, and engineering procedures
  • Provide hands-on field leadership for site commissioning, protective relay testing and coordination, and troubleshooting, including factory acceptance testing (FAT), site acceptance testing (SAT), and field commissioning support
  • Mentor and provide technical guidance to junior and mid-level engineers on MV and HV design standards, field practices, and engineering best practices
  • Evaluate engineering alternatives and design decisions with consideration for safety, reliability, constructability, operability, schedule, and lifecycle cost.
  • Evaluate emerging electrical technologies across BESS, natural gas generation, renewables, and distributed energy systems


What You Bring to the Team:

  • Bachelor's degree in electrical engineering or related field (Master's degree a plus).
  • Active Professional Engineer (PE) license in Electrical Engineering (Power) strongly preferred
  • 8+ years of engineering experience in power generation, substation design, BESS, transmission & distribution, renewables, or related energy sectors, including direct, hands-on MV and HV design and field experience
  • Extensive, hands-on experience with LV, MV, and HV design and field execution, including equipment sizing, protection & control, relay coordination, grounding, switchgear, power transformers, and SCADA/RTU integration. Substation protection & controls (P&C) experience is strongly preferred.
  • Demonstrated experience supporting EPC projects during detailed design, construction, startup, and commercial operation.
  • Proficiency in power generation concepts, electrical protection, communications protocols, and equipment sizing
  • Experience performing or reviewing power system studies, including load flow, short circuit, grounding, arc flash, and protective device coordination analyses.
  • Strong familiarity with applicable codes and standards (e.g., NEC, NESC, IEEE, IEEE C37 substation/protection standards, NFPA)
  • Demonstrated leadership experience, including mentoring junior engineers and directing multi-disciplinary project teams
